In Tuscany, on the northern flank of the hilltop town of Montalcino,
lies the Pertimali estate. The terrain is Eocenic origin with
marl and clay alternating with limestone, situated on slopes with
sufficient inclination for water to drain off rapidly and well.
Angelo Sassetti began producing wine 7 years ago in a small winery
built into the farmhouse, From his acres of hand manicured vineyards
and rigorous control over crop level, Angelo’s small lot
and unfiltered winemaking produces 10,000 - 12,000 bottles of
Rosso and 15,000 - 18,000 bottles of Brunello. The most important
factor in the excellence achieved by Angelo Sassetti with his
Rosso & Brunello di Montalcino is his total dedication to
every stage of his wines from his hand care of his vineyards,
to his total involvement in each of the procedures in his cellars.
That is why his vineyards think of him as Angelo “the angel”
Sassetti.
